    When I was cutting the letters out I first covered the letters in vinyl to protect them. Im thinking the reverse would be an easy way to cover the black part and wet paint the letters. Thats what I'm going to do. Just cover the whole set with vinyl, cut along the grooves (carefully) and remove the vinyl covering the white parts. opposite of what I did to begin with. Easy and not so painstaking...
